Subject: Re: [PATCH] net: phy: at803x: select correct page on initialization

On Mon, Mar 23, 2020 at 05:27:30PM +0100, David Bauer wrote:
> The Atheros AR8031 and AR8033 expose different registers for SGMII/Fiber
> as well as the copper side of the PHY depending on the BT_BX_REG_SEL bit
> in the chip configure register.
> 
> The driver assumes the copper side is selected on probe, but this might
> not be the case depending which page was last selected by the
> bootloader.
> 
> Select the copper page when initializing the configuration to circumvent
> this.

Hi David

You might want to look at phy_read_paged(), phy_write_paged(), etc,
depending on your needs. There can be locking issues, which these
functions address.
